Text

(1)(a) Except as otherwise provided in subsection (1.5) of this section, a person commits wholesale promotion of obscenity if, knowing its content and character, such person wholesale promotes or possesses with intent to wholesale promote any obscene material.
(b)Wholesale promotion of obscenity is a class 1 misdemeanor. (1.5) (a) A person commits wholesale promotion of obscenity to a minor if, knowing its content and character, such person wholesale promotes to a minor or possesses with intent to wholesale promote to a minor any obscene material.
(b)Wholesale promotion of obscenity to a minor is a class 6 felony.
